The EPIKORE 11 is a 4½-way floor-standing loudspeaker featuring no fewer than four 8-inch woofers, a newly developed 6½-inch midrange driver, and an advanced EVO-K Hybrid tweeter in a low-resonance and luxurious cabinet, crafted by DALI in Denmark. DIAPHRAGMS
The EPIKORE 11 incorporates our characteristic paper and wood fibre diaphragm technology, which reduces weight and adds stiffness to promote non-resonant breakup characteristics. With wood fibre diaphragm technology, the EPIKORE 11 brings out the finest musical details and dynamics.

LOW DISTORTION
First introduced in the flagship DALI KORE loudspeaker, SMC Gen-2 is the latest generation of magnet technology, offering astonishingly low loss and distortion values, thus ensuring highly dynamic and authentic sound reproduction. SMC Gen-2 is integrated into both the bass and midrange drivers of the EPIKORE, as well as in the inductor cores of the crossovers.
ASTONISHINGLY SMOOTH
Experience astonishingly smooth, effortless highs and dynamics at any volume with the EVO-K Hybrid Tweeter Module. This module features an ultra-light 35 mm soft dome tweeter (in-house development) and a wide-band ribbon element with powerful neodymium magnet motor systems.
